XML 90 R78.htm IDEA: XBRL DOCUMENT v3.23.1
Income Taxes - Reconciliation of Differences Between Federal Income Tax Rate and Total Income Tax Expense (Details) - USD ($)
$ in Thousands
3 Months Ended 12 Months Ended
Dec. 31, 2022
Sep. 30, 2022
Jun. 30, 2022
Mar. 31, 2022
Dec. 31, 2021
Sep. 30, 2021
Jun. 30, 2021
Mar. 31, 2021
Dec. 31, 2022
Dec. 31, 2021
Dec. 31, 2020
Income Tax Expense (Benefit), Effective Income Tax Rate Reconciliation, Amount [Abstract]                      
Income tax, at federal rate                 $ (7,738) $ 7,195 $ 1,099
State and local tax, net of federal benefit                 (5,035) 2,034 (57)
Valuation allowance, net of federal benefit                 5,592 (1,119) 228
Other                 336 99 112
(Benefit) provision for income taxes $ (2,589) $ (820) $ (488) $ (2,948) $ 4,245 $ 1,318 $ 1,914 $ 732 $ (6,845) $ 8,209 $ 1,382